Bug ID: 87043 Summary: maybe-uninitialized warning for initialized variable Product: gcc Version: 8.1.1 Status: UNCONFIRMED Severity: normal Priority: P3 Component: fortran Assignee: unassigned at gcc dot gnu.org Reporter: pvitt at posteo dot de Target Milestone: --- We have a MWE that provokes a "may be uninitialized" warning despite the value being initialized in all cases. Additionally, this warning is only created with -O[1,2,3,s,fast}, but not with -O{g}.
